In the mid-2000s, the 240x320 pixel resolution was the gold standard for premium mobile gaming. It offered the perfect balance of crisp pixel art and performance. Hands Mobile and EA Mobile pushed these tiny screens to their absolute limits, delivering massive worlds that fit into JAR files measuring less than 1 megabyte. Heroes Lore 2 was the pinnacle of this technical wizardry, offering a visual and gameplay depth that rivaled handheld consoles like the Game Boy Advance. 2.
